diff options
Diffstat (limited to 'src/plugins/docker/dockerdevice.h')
-rw-r--r-- | src/plugins/docker/dockerdevice.h |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/src/plugins/docker/dockerdevice.h b/src/plugins/docker/dockerdevice.h index ea2f0d21feb..8c575b08ad6 100644 --- a/src/plugins/docker/dockerdevice.h +++ b/src/plugins/docker/dockerdevice.h @@ -8,7 +8,7 @@ #include <projectexplorer/devicesupport/idevice.h> #include <projectexplorer/devicesupport/idevicefactory.h> -#include <QMutex> +#include <utils/synchronizedvalue.h> namespace Docker::Internal { @@ -92,8 +92,7 @@ public: void shutdownExistingDevices(); private: - QMutex m_deviceListMutex; - std::vector<std::weak_ptr<DockerDevice>> m_existingDevices; + Utils::SynchronizedValue<std::vector<std::weak_ptr<DockerDevice>>> m_existingDevices; }; } // namespace Docker::Internal |